Description
We are increasingly questioning the use of chemicals for crop pest control. Biological control is an important method in an integrated pest management program by contributing to the reduction of environmental pollution. The general objective of the project is to analyze biological alternatives in pest control in order to reduce the use of toxic pesticides in grain storage. The specific objectives are: Evaluate the use of entomopathogenic fungi (Beauveria Bassiana and Metharhizium anisoplye) in the gorgjos control (Sitophilus zeama and obtectus acanthoscelides) in stored corn and beans stored grains. Hypothesis: That the Entomopathogen B. Bassiana fungus controls the gorgos than M. anisoplye and that the biological control of pests is the same as the chemical control in lowering the population of gorgy gorgers in stored grains stored by corn and beans. In the control of stored corn and beans -stored pests, fungi B. Bassiana and M. Anisoplye will be used in 4 doses in front of a chemical and an absolute witness. The corn grains will be infested with adult gorgjos of Sitophilus zeamais and the beans with obtectus acanthoscelides. 2 test and greenhouse tests will be carried out using a BCA design with 10 treatments and 3 repetitions. For the evaluation, the number of dead insects will be analyzed in each of the treatments, percentage of damage to corn and beans, number of piercations per grain, percentage of weight loss and analysis and identification of contaminating fungi of the grains.
